Comprehending Binary Addition and Subtraction Made Simple

Binary arithmetic operates on a system of just two digits: 0 and 1. Addition in binary is straightforward. When you add two binary numbers, you check each place value, starting from the rightmost digit. If the sum of the digits in a particular place value is 0|one|1, the result for that place value is also zero|one|1. If the sum is 2, you write down 0 and carry over 1 to the next place value. Subtraction in binary follows a similar procedure.

  • Imagine adding binary numbers like 101 + 110.
  • Each column represents a different power of 2, starting from the rightmost column as 2^0|one|1.
  • Keep in mind that carrying over is essential when the sum exceeds one.
